R-670-12-85RESOLUTION NO. 670-12-85(R) A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F ALLEN, COLLIN COUNTY, TEXAS, DETERMINING A PUBLIC NECESSITY FOR THE ACQUISITION OF EASEMENTS, PERMANENT AND TEMPORARY, OVER AND UPON ALL LAND NECESSARY TO CONSTRUCT PROJECTED PUBLIC IMPROVEMENTS, TO WIT: A SANITARY SEWER SYSTEM WITHIN THE CITY LIMITS OF THE CITY OF ALLEN, TEXAS, ON THOSE TRACTS OR PARCELS OF LAND LOCATED IN THE CITY OF ALLEN, COLLIN COUNTY, TEXAS, AND DESCRIBED MORE PARTICULARLY IN EXHIBITS "A" AND "B" ATTACHED HERETO; AUTHORIZING THE CITY ATTORNEY TO FILE PROCEEDINGS IN EMINENT DOMAIN TO ACQUIRE THE NEEDED EASEMENTS; A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E DATE. W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Allen, Collin County, Texas, upon consideration of the matter, has determined that the public necessity for the health, safety and welfare of the citizens of the City of Allen requires and will be promoted by the construction of protected improvements, to wit: a sanitary sewer system within the city limits of the City of Allen, Texas, on those tracts or parcels of land described more particularly in Exhibits "A" and "B" attached hereto and made a part hereof as though fully incorporated (hereinafter called "sewer improvements"); and, WHEREAS, in accordance with the above, the City Council of the City of Allen, Texas, hereby finds that it is necessary and in the public interest to acquire right-of-way and easements, permanent and temporary (for construction purposes) across and upon land within which the sewer improvements will be constructed, and which will be a part of the public sewer system of the City for the benefit and enjoyment of the citizens of the City of Allen; and, W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Allen, Texas, finds and determines that permanent and temporary construction easements in and to the above-described lands is suitable for such purpose and that it is necessary to acquire the same for said sewer improvements. NOW TH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E THE CITY OF ALLEN, TEXAS: SECTION 1. The City- Council hereby finds and determines that it is necessary for the health, safety and welfare of its citizens; is in the public interest; and Resolution No. 670-12-85(R) - Page 1 will promote the health, safety and welfare of the citizens of Allen, to acquire permanent and temporary construction easements to all lands necessary to construct the aforementioned sewer improvements, which will be used as a part of the public sewer system of the City of Allen. SECTION 2. The City Attorney or his duly authorized representative, is hereby authorized and directed to file or cause to be filed, against all owners and lien holders, proceedings in eminent domain to acquire permanent and temporary easements that may be necessary to construct the aforementioned sewer improvements. SECTION 3. The findings of fact, recitations and provisions set out in the preamble of this Resolution are adopted and made a part of the body of this Resolution, as fully as if the same were set forth herein. SECTION 4. This Resolution shall become effectived immediately from and after its approval.
